1. Each Genre Trains Your Brain Differently
• Fiction develops empathy, emotional intelligence, and imagination.
• Nonfiction improves knowledge, critical thinking, and practical skills.
• Poetry encourages observation and sensitivity to nuance.
• Science fiction and fantasy expand conceptual thinking and innovation.
By mixing genres, your brain learns multiple ways to process, analyze, and create.
2. Sparks Creative Connections
Reading different genres allows your mind to connect unrelated ideas.
For example, a historical biography might inspire a business solution, or a sci-fi novel may spark creative art concepts. These cross-genre connections are what fuel innovation.
